Title: the wallworm is exporting my models in strange shapes? please help me
Post by: omegadavid99 on February 21, 2013, 12:27:54 PM
when i tried to export a tank model to gmod it be a minature tank in game. and when i tried a cheaply made tank to export in gmod it is flat please help me

I opened the file you sent and discovered why the size would be all wrong. The model's scale was very high. In other words, you scaled it up with the scale tool.

Generally speaking, it is a very good habit to form that you not scale objects at the object level with the scale tool. You get more predictable results if you scale it at the sub-object level (like the Element sub-object level).

However, that isn't always convenient. So, instead, get in the habit of doing this: when you are done scaling/rotating a prop, apply an XForm modifier to it. Then collapse it to an editable poly. Then export with WW.

Note this isn't really a Wall Worm issue. It is a general principle in Max. I suggest reading about the XForm modifier and the Reset XForm function.

Regarding a flat model, I'm an not sure unless you send it to me too. My guess is that is too may need an Xform modifier.
